Captain Steve Caldwell and striker Stephen Elliot both made successful returns from injury in the reserves’ win at Leeds…

A goal from Tobias Hysen and two from late substitute David Dowson ensured that Dennis Wise would have a lot to think about his new side.

Caldwell played 60 minutes and Elliot 25 minutes, with the former coming straight into contention for the match at Hull this Saturday after Kenny Cunningham’s injury. Elliot is hoping to be back in time for Cardiff’s visit to Sunderland next Tuesday.

Roy Keane would have been happy with what he saw at Leeds’ Thorpe Arch training ground, with all three goals scored in the second half.

Former Leeds youngster Kevin Smith fed through Hysen, who finished well to put Sunderland ahead after 53 minutes.

The score remained the same until the last seven minutes, when sub Dowson scored two goals, finishing rebounds from two shots from the lively Elliot.
